Default Word 2003 - shift/return problem


Hi - I'm trying to format a long document for a directory. It was given
to me with 'shift/return's at the end of each line/paragraph instead of
just 'return's. As a result each time I try to, for instance, justify a
section, it effects the entire text and it's driving me insane. If
anyone could tell me a way to, in effect, split the text up, or replace
the 'shift/return' for a full return, I'd be eternally grateful.
Otherwise I fear it will be an absurdly boring exercise...
